Hospice is a form of compassionate and quality care for people facing a life-limiting illness or injury. Hospice is provided wherever the patient calls home, designed to make the end-of-life experience a positive one. Rather than trying to cure an illness, the goal of hospice is to make the patient comfortable, ease pain and other troublesome symptoms and support the family during this challenging time.
